Israeli raids displaced tens of thousands in the West Bank ...
1 day ago · Approximately 40,000 Palestinians were driven from their homes in January and February in the largest displacement in the West Bank since Israel captured the territory in the 1967 Mideast war. Israel says the operations are needed to stamp out militancy as violence by all sides has surged since Hamas’ Oct. 7, 2023, attack ignited the war in Gaza.
